> We had the same discussions and the same conclusion, wifi is not good for 
> this.   One reason is  you can’t trust the result.  You can’t say a person 
> was in a certain building because they may have forgot their phone, not 
> registered yet.   You can’t say a person was not in a building because many 
> devices registered to a person are stationary and connect even when the 
> person is not there.  So any data you pull is inconclusive at best.

> We ducked this by explaining our wireless design was created for coverage, 
> not security/triangulation, which is true.  Many of our buildings do not have 
> the capability to do triagulation because of AP positions.  We didn't even 
> get into the privacy item, which was honestly a relief.
